20-134 Discriminatory practices; violation; penalty.

20-134. Discriminatory practices; violation; penalty.Any person who directly or indirectly refuses, withholds from, denies, or attempts to refuse, withhold, or deny, to any other person any of the accommodations, advantages, facilities, services, or privileges, or who segregates any person in a place of public accommodation on the basis of race, creed, color, sex, religion, national origin, or ancestry, shall be guilty of discriminatory practice and shall be subject to the penalties of sections 20-132 to 20-143. SourceLaws 1973, LB 112, § 3; Laws 1974, LB 681, § 2.
